    I always book airfare separately. I booked our Dec trip in Feb. I started checking about three times a week in search of the best airfare. We have found that booking directly with our selected Airline as being the best. This may not be the case if you live in a larger city. I live in a small state and in a rural setting, so this works best for me...unless I want to drive several hours and spend the night..Which generally is more costly overall.

    Leaving mid week does make a difference. Booking early saved me over 300 US per person..compared to what the flight is now. Granted, I am leaving mid December....but April is also spring break for many colleges...so I would definitely start checking now. Hope this helps some. Once you start looking regularly, you will get a feel for the pricing. Try looking at some other dates to get acclimated to the charges. Good luck and enjoy Negril in April!!!     Being in NY does have it's advantages I guess. Still can find RT air for ~$325 sometimes. Your best best is like Yetta said. Keep looking often, esp. midweek, try multiple combinations (I use flexible dates option in the search engine) and you will get a feel for the flow of it. Try signing up for an airfare alert service like Airfare Watchdog. http://www.airfarewatchdog.com You put in the parameters and they notify you when a good deal comes along.

    Kayak.com helped me find price drops for both of my upcoming trips. I signed up for daily email alerts for 2 or 3 departure/return combos. Every night around 11:00 pm I get my price alert for the day. I knew the typical best price to go for as well as the desired flight times, and was able to jump on it immediately. 12-14 hours later, the price had gone up already. I booked in June for both November and April, the price only dropped lower once, not for my exact dates (weekend flights) but for Tuesday or Wednesday departure and return.

    The email alert will also show suggested dates when the prices are lower. The email shows the 4 or 5 carriers with the lowest prices and what those prices are as well as how many stops. Major airlines don't fly direct from my city (unfortunately) so it shows 1 stop prices as well as 2 stops (or more). We do have 2 charter airlines with direct flights, unfortunately it doesn't show those but they're also usually the highest price of course.
